Why Northern Missouri Fleets Keep Asking About Portable Lifts

Rural and county fleet shops across northern Missouri deal with a specific problem: bay space is fixed, but the vehicle mix keeps growing. A department running plow trucks, pickups, and utility vans out of a single garage often has one stall with a permanent lift and every other stall doing floor jack work. That’s where the portable vehicle scissor lift conversation starts. It doesn’t require a structural review or a concrete pour, and it can be repositioned to whichever bay has an open vehicle that day, which matters a lot when a shop only has two or three techs covering a wide service area.

We’ve helped fleet customers plan installs where a shop needs two units immediately for a priority location and a few more staged in afterward for satellite garages. That kind of phased rollout is common with county and municipal budgets, and a portable vehicle scissor lift fits that model better than a stationary lift because you’re not locked into one bay’s dimensions before you even know your final vehicle count. It also lets a fleet test one unit’s fit with their actual truck lineup before committing budget to a full rollout.

Symmetric vs Asymmetric Arms for CV Axle and Half-Shaft Work

CV axle and half-shaft replacement is underbody work that rewards a specific kind of clearance, and this is where arm geometry decides whether your techs love or hate the lift. Symmetric arms center the vehicle evenly, which works fine for oil changes and tire rotations but can leave a technician reaching awkwardly around a frame member to get a slide hammer or axle puller into position at the hub. Asymmetric arm setups shift the vehicle slightly forward and off-center, opening a clear line to the front hubs and CV joints where most half-shaft work happens on front-wheel-drive and all-wheel-drive fleet vehicles.

For fleets running a mix of pickups and vans, we generally recommend evaluating arm reach against your most common half-shaft job, not your least common one. A portable vehicle scissor lift with adjustable or extended platform width gives techs room to work a slide hammer and torque wrench without repositioning the vehicle mid-job. If your fleet’s driveline work skews toward rear-wheel-drive trucks doing U-joint and differential service instead, that shifts the ideal arm geometry rearward, so it’s worth mapping out your actual repair order history before locking in a configuration rather than guessing.

Height Adjustment: Why Locking Stages Matter for Driveline Jobs

Half-shaft and CV axle work often needs a specific working height, not maximum height. A tech pulling a half-shaft usually wants the vehicle up enough to get a puller and slide hammer working freely, but not necessarily raised to the lift’s full travel, which just adds time to every cycle. A quality portable vehicle scissor lift locks mechanically at intervals of roughly two to two and a half inches, letting a crew choose the exact working height for the job in front of them instead of treating the lift as an all-the-way-up or all-the-way-down tool.

This matters even more in a shop running multiple job types back to back. A tech doing a quick CV boot inspection can lock the lift low and get underneath fast, while a full half-shaft replacement might call for a higher lock stage to give room for swinging tools and pulling the axle clear. Locking mechanically rather than relying on hydraulic pressure to hold position is also the safety feature that separates a properly built lift from a bargain unit, and it’s worth confirming in writing before you commit a fleet budget to any specific model.

Matching Load Capacity to Your Actual Fleet, Not the Average Vehicle

Fleet managers sometimes size a lift around their most common vehicle and forget about the outliers. A department running mostly half-ton trucks but occasionally servicing a one-ton unit with a loaded utility box needs a portable vehicle scissor lift rated for the heaviest vehicle that will ever sit on it, with margin, not the average across the fleet. We always ask for actual curb weight on the heaviest regular unit before recommending a capacity tier, because guessing low on capacity is the single most common mistake we see fleets make on a first purchase.

Duty cycle is the other half of that equation. A county shop running CV axle and half-shaft jobs several times a week puts different wear on hydraulic components than a shop doing occasional inspections. We spec differently based on that pattern, and it’s a conversation worth having before you buy rather than after a lift starts showing wear ahead of schedule under heavier-than-expected use.

Setup Discipline: The One Thing Portable Lifts Require That Fixed Lifts Don’t

Portability is the whole appeal of a portable vehicle scissor lift, but it comes with one added responsibility: every time the unit moves to a new spot on the shop floor, your crew has to verify the surface is level and rated for the load before raising anything. That’s not a knock against portable equipment, it’s just a step that a bolted-down lift skips because it never moves. Skipping this step is where preventable problems start, especially in older municipal garages with uneven or patched concrete.

We train fleet crews to treat every relocation like a first-time setup: check the surface, center the vehicle before raising, confirm mechanical locks are engaged before anyone works underneath, and never rely on hydraulic pressure alone to hold a raised vehicle. Build this into a written checklist for your shop and the safety profile of a portable lift matches anything permanent on the floor. It’s a five-minute habit that prevents the kind of incident that costs a fleet a lot more than five minutes.

Planning a Multi-Site Rollout Across County or Regional Garages

Northern Missouri fleets often run more than one garage, and that’s exactly the scenario where portable equipment earns its keep. We’ve quoted rollouts where a priority shop gets units first, with additional lifts scheduled into satellite locations once the first site’s crew is trained. That staggered timeline lets a fleet manager confirm the configuration works for their actual repair order mix before scaling the purchase across every garage in the county.

Service and support should scale the same way. A fleet running multiple portable lifts across different sites benefits from one point of contact tracking service history, lock mechanism inspections, and hydraulic fluid checks across every unit, rather than treating each garage as an isolated account. We keep that kind of record deliberately, because a fleet manager shouldn’t have to dig through separate paperwork for every location just to know when a given lift is due for service.
